What is a CNC Router? A CNC router is a computer-controlled machine that uses a rotating cutting bit to shape and machine various materials. Unlike handheld routers, CNC routers offer precision and repeatability through computerized numerical control. They are widely used across numerous industries for diverse applications. Understanding CNC Router Technology
CNC routers function by following programmed instructions to guide the cutting bit along precise paths. These instructions are generated using Computer-Aided Design (CAD) and Computer-Aided Manufacturing (CAM) software. The software translates design files into machine-readable instructions, dictating the speed, depth, and trajectory of the cutting bit. This ensures consistent and accurate results, eliminating the inconsistencies of manual routing. The precision of CNC routers is critical for applications requiring high accuracy, such as in aerospace and medical device manufacturing. Key Technical Features of CNC Routers
The performance and capabilities of CNC routers depend heavily on their technical specifications. Below is a comparison table highlighting key features:
Feature | Description | Importance |
---|---|---|
Axis Configuration | 3-axis (X, Y, Z), 4-axis (X, Y, Z, A), 5-axis (X, Y, Z, A, B) | Determines the machine’s ability to create complex shapes and 3D models. |
Working Area | The maximum size of material the machine can process. | Dictates the size of projects the machine can handle. |
Spindle Power | The power of the motor driving the cutting bit. | Impacts cutting speed and the ability to machine hard materials. |
Spindle Speed | The rotational speed of the cutting bit. | Affects surface finish and the types of materials that can be processed. |
Control System | The software and hardware controlling the machine’s movements. | Influences the machine’s precision, ease of use, and programming capabilities. |
Material Compatibility | The types of materials the machine can process (wood, metal, plastic, etc.). | Determines the machine’s versatility and application range. |
Types of CNC Routers
CNC routers come in various types, each suited for specific applications and budgets. Here’s a comparison of common types:
Type | Size | Applications | Advantages | Disadvantages |
---|---|---|---|---|
Desktop CNC Router | Compact | Hobbyist projects, small-scale production, prototyping | Affordable, easy to use, space-saving | Limited working area, lower power, less robust |
Industrial CNC Router | Large | High-volume production, large-scale projects, complex machining operations | High power, large working area, robust construction | Expensive, requires more space, complex operation |
ATC CNC Router | Varies | High-speed production, efficient tool changes | Increased efficiency, reduced downtime | Higher initial cost |
Multi-Spindle CNC Router | Varies | High-volume production of identical parts | Significantly increased production speed | High initial cost, less flexible for diverse projects |

1. What is the difference between a 3-axis, 4-axis, and 5-axis CNC router?
A 3-axis CNC router moves along X, Y, and Z axes. A 4-axis machine adds a rotary axis (A) for additional shaping capabilities. A 5-axis machine includes a second rotary axis (B), enabling complex 3D machining.

3. What safety precautions should I take when operating a CNC router?
Always wear appropriate safety gear, including eye protection, hearing protection, and gloves. Ensure the workpiece is securely clamped. Never reach into the cutting area while the machine is running.
4. What kind of maintenance is required for a CNC router?
Regular maintenance includes cleaning, lubrication, and inspection of moving parts. Replace worn cutting bits promptly. Consult the manufacturer’s instructions for a detailed maintenance schedule.
